    Terms Of Refrigeration And Air Conditioning CİK109 FALL 3+1 C 5
    Learning Outcomes
    1-Recognizes refrigeration and air conditioning, lists the mechanical compression refrigeration system elements.
    2-Explains the basic principles of heat and temperature, recognizes temperature measuring devices, concepts such as thermal capacity, enthalpy and entropy.
    3-Applies the gas laws, explains the pressure concepts and their units, recognizes the pressure-temperature relationship, the concepts of saturated liquid, saturated steam, dry steam and superheated steam, uses pressure-enthalpy diagrams.

  • Course Content
  • Week Topics Study Metarials
    1 Definition of refrigeration and air conditioning and explanation of usage areas R1 SR1
    2 Mechanical cooling system components and their tasks R1 SR1
    3 Explanation of the difference between Air Conditioning and Refrigeration. Commercial application of Air Conditioning and Refrigeration. R1 SR1
    4 Classification of Air Conditioning products R1 SR1
    5 Heat or thermal energy and thermal kinetic energy definition (sensible energy) and thermal potential energy (hidden heat) . R1 SR1
    6 Defining the temperature, the temperature scale (thermometer) , thermal capacity, or "specific heat" and implementating them to air and water problems. R1 SR1
    7 Making a heat balance, calculating the energy entering and leaving a system R1 SR1
    8 Explanation of Joule, Charles, Dalton laws R1 SR1
    9 General gas law and its applications R1 SR1
    10 Explanation of pressure units and making conversions R1 SR1
    11 Refrigerant fluid pressure-enthalpy diagram R1 SR1
    12 Demonstration of heat exchange in the cooling system on a pressure enthalpy diagram R1 SR1
    13 Explanation of conduction and heat transfer and deriving general equations R1 SR1
    14 Explanation of convection, radiation and heat transfer by equation R1 SR1

    Goals Explanation of basic concepts and rules about air conditioning and cooling. The relationship between heat, temperature, heat transfer and related calculations. Getting to know the basic cooling system.
    Content Explanation of the basic concepts of refrigeration, air conditioning, relations between pressure, temperature, volume in refrigeration systems, solution of sample problems, heat transfer methods and calculation, basic mechanical cooling system study
